A self-consistent thermodynamic framework is presented for power law canonical distributions of the Zipf-Mandelbrot type based on the generalized central-limit theorem by extending the discussion given by Khinchin for deriving Gibbsian canonical ensemble theory. The thermodynamic Legendre transform structure is invoked in establishing its connection to nonextensive statistical mechanics.
